Merc W05 set for Jerez rollout

Mercedes are set to reveal their eagerly-awaited 2014 car, the W05, on the opening morning of the Jerez test later this month.The major regulation changes being introduced for the forthcoming campaign have made year's pre-season schedule the most anticipated for years, with uncertainty over how both the various cars will look and ultimately perform. Mercedes' W05 challenger and all-new V6 turbocharged engine are poised to come under particularly close scrutiny owing to the Brackley team's long-time status as many pundits' tip to steal a march on the field.
